Expanding the horizons of ArPPh2: New applications of triarylphosphane ligands are presented. The Pd–L1 and Pd–L2 complexes offer exceptionally high activity in Suzuki–Miyaura cross‐couplings of aryl chlorides. The extremely congested synthesis of tetra‐ortho‐substituted biaryl compounds is achieved for the first time by simply using triarylphosphane ligands.

Ambiphilic molecules, which contain a Lewis base and Lewisacid, are of great interest based on their unique ability to activate small molecules. Phosphine boronates are one class of these substrates that have interesting catalytic activity.
